The 1982 Australian Endurance Championship of Makes was open to cars complying with CAMS Group C Touring Car regulations. The title was contested over a five round series:
- Round 1 : Perrier Gold Cup, Oran Park, NSW, 22 August
- Round 2 : Castrol 400, Sandown, Vic, 12 September
- Round 3 : James Hardie 1000, Mount Panorama, Bathurst, NSW, 3 October
- Round 4 : Gold Coast 300, Surfers Paradise International Raceway, Qld, 7 November
- Round 5 : Nissan-Datsun 300, Adelaide International Raceway, SA, 5 December
Cars competed in four engine capacity classes:
- Class A : Up to 1600cc
- Class B : 1601 to 2000cc
- Class C : 2001 to 3000cc
- Class D : 3001 to 6000cc
Championship rounds were contested concurrently with those of the 1982 Australian Endurance Championship.
Championship results were as follows:
Position | Make | Car | R1 | R2 | R3 | R4 | R5 | Points |
1 | Nissan | Bluebird Turbo | 6 | 9 | 9 | 9 | 9 | 42 |
2 | Ford | Falcon XE, Falcon XD, Capri & Escort | 9 | 4 | 9 | 6 | 9 | 37 |
3 | Mazda | RX-7 | 4 | 9 | 1 | 9 | 9 | 32 |
4 | Toyota | Corolla Levin & Celica | 6 | 9 | 6 | 9 | - | 30 |
5 | Holden | Commodore VH | 2 | 6 | 9 | 2 | 6 | 25 |
6 | Isuzu | Gemini | - | 9 | - | 6 | 9 | 24 |
7 | Triumph | Dolomite | - | 4 | - | 3 | 6 | 13 |
8 | Mitsubishi | Lancer & Colt | - | 6 | - | 6 | - | 12 |
9 | Alfa Romeo | GTV & GTV6 | - | 6 | 2 | 2 | - | 10 |
10 | Audi | 5 + 5 | - | - | 3 | 3 | - | 6 |
11 | BMW | 635 CSi | 3 | - | 2 | - | - | 5 |
